The successful resolution of over 60,000 cases through the National Lok Adalat demonstrates a significant push toward streamlining legal proceedings in Andhra Pradesh. By involving multiple stakeholders such as judiciary officers and representatives from various agencies like police and insurance companies, this initiative underlines the importance of collaborative efforts in addressing legal backlogs. Moreover,compensations amounting to ₹109 crore provide relief to affected petitioners and potentially restore public trust in alternative dispute resolution mechanisms.
Efforts like these can help alleviate pressure on conventional courts while creating precedents for expedited justice delivery models across India. If consistently implemented at scale nationwide with similar efficiency as seen here under APSLSA’s coordination,such measures may contribute meaningfully toward reducing India’s caseload backlog-a perennial issue within its judicial system.
